The situation in the Shkodra Region appears calm, under constant monitoring by Civil Emergency structures.

The hydrometeorological situation in the territory of the Shkodra District appears calm and stabilized, according to the official report dated 09.01.2026 from the municipalities, Civil Protection structures and responsible institutions.

In the Municipality of Shkodra, no Civil Emergency issues are reported. In the Dajç administrative unit, the water level is recorded at 6.20 meters, while in the Old Buna Bridge the water level remains below the critical level without further increase. Even in the Bahçallek Bridge, the level of the Drin River has decreased and is estimated to be below the critical level. In the village of Obot, there continues to be water on the main road, where the Armed Forces with high-pass vehicles are assisting residents in their movement.

In the Municipality of Vau i Dejës, Malësi e Madhe, Pukë and Fushë-Arrëz the situation appears calm, with no rainfall during the night and no reported problems. In Malësi e Madhe, water withdrawal has been identified in the “Rreze e Veshtit” area, Kastrat administrative unit, where work is being done to restore full access.

According to the Lezha Irrigation and Drainage Directorate, the hydropower plants in Vilu and Casi are operating at full capacity, while the embankments, drainage channels and the Shkodra Reservoir dam do not present any problems. The Kir and Gjadër rivers have recorded a significant decrease in flows, helping to stabilize the situation.

The Vau i Dejës Military Unit continues its engagement in the village of Obot with equipment and personnel, while the Shkodra District Prefecture remains on alert and under constant monitoring for any possible development./ CNA
